How to Find NFT Games Early?

If you're willing to put in some extra effort upfront, then your chances of finding good projects increase dramatically. Let's look at 5 tactics to do so.

1. Launchpads

Crypto launchpads connect emerging project developers introducing them to captive audiences of early stage retail investors. They also serve the important role of fundraising and helping them get established.

Launchpads come in various varieties. NFT launchpads are a great way to identify and get in early on promising NFT projects.

2. Twitter

Twitter is often the first place that new NFT creators go to market. By using follower trackers like FollowLiker, you can follow along with major names in crypto, who are often among the first to follow fresh new NFT creators on Twitter.

3. NFT aggregators

Once NFT projects get close to launch, they often reach out to aggregation sites, like HowRare(.)is for Solana, Rarity Tools for Ethereum, and NFT Calendar.

Just like flight aggregators like Kayak or Expedia, these sites aggregate data from various sources and present it in an easy-to-use format. The same concept applies to NFT aggregators; they aggregate data from various sources to give you a better idea of ​​what The market is offering at any given time.

4. Minting Monitors

Tools like icy(.)tools and whatsminting(.)live monitor all NFT contracts being minted on Ethereum so you can see a real-time feed of NFT mints. Raider(.)com and playtoearn(.)net are good to research the best NFT games early.

This means you'll be right at the forefront of the NFT market as new projects launch. You can use this information to identify promising projects before anyone else, and then you can jump on them before they blow up. With that said, it's always ideal to find out about projects before they've even minted.

How do NFT Play-to-Earn Games Work?

Essentially, there are two big ways of how NFT gaming cryptocurrency works - you could either play games to earn rewards within them, or earn actual cryptocurrencies as you play.

First of all, earning in-game rewards. The NFT gaming platforms that offer such opportunities do usually have NFT characters for you to unlock, earn, and use within the game. Axie Infinity is a good example of an in-game reward-providing project.

Secondly, there are games that will allow you to earn cryptocurrencies as you play. Mobox NFT gaming project would be the perfect example here.

With these types of games, you will essentially be able to earn in-game currency or tokens for certain actions that you perform. These tokens can then be staked, with the possibility to earn various rewards.
